Quick Specification Table — Maruti Suzuki Grand Vitara Nepal
| Specification | Details (Nepal) |
|---|---|
| Price (Showroom, Nepal) | NPR 67.99 lakh – NPR 76.29 lakh (Zeta to Alpha trims) |
| Extended Price Range | Up to NPR 88 lakh depending on batch and options |
| Engine Options | 1.5L mild-hybrid petrol / 1.5L strong hybrid |
| Power Output | 88 – 102 bhp |
| Transmission | Manual, Automatic, e-CVT (hybrid) |
| Ground Clearance | 210 mm |
| Seating | 5 persons |
| Fuel Economy (Claimed) | Up to 25 kmpl on hybrid |
| Safety | Airbags, ABS, ESC, Hill Hold, ISOFIX |
| Warranty (Typical) | 3 years / 100,000 km (confirm hybrid coverage) |
Maruti Suzuki Grand Vitara Price in Nepal

The Grand Vitara is sold in Nepal through Suzuki’s official dealer network.
Prices vary depending on the variant, hybrid options, and imported batches.
As of 2025, the Grand Vitara price in Nepal starts around NPR 67.99 lakh for the mid Zeta variant.
The higher Alpha trims are priced between NPR 75.99 lakh to NPR 76.29 lakh.
Some market portals and car listings also suggest that depending on the trim, dual-tone paint, and optional packages, the price can go as high as NPR 88 lakh.
It is important to note that these are showroom prices.
On-road costs will be higher due to import duty, VAT, registration, and insurance.

Variants Available in Nepal

The Maruti Suzuki Grand Vitara is available in multiple trims globally, but only selected variants are imported into Nepal.
The most common options here include mild-hybrid and strong hybrid (intelligent hybrid) models.
Nepali customers usually get trims like Sigma, Zeta, and Alpha, with the Alpha offering the most premium features.
Some batches have also brought in AllGrip AWD (all-wheel-drive) models, which are particularly useful for Nepali roads with frequent rain, steep inclines, and rough patches.

Engine and Hybrid Options
The Grand Vitara offers two main powertrain options:
- A 1.5-litre mild-hybrid petrol engine paired with a manual or automatic gearbox.
- A 1.5-litre intelligent hybrid system with stronger electric motor support and e-CVT transmission.
The mild-hybrid is well-suited for daily city driving and moderate fuel savings.
The intelligent hybrid is ideal for buyers who want maximum fuel efficiency and lower running costs.
On Nepali roads, especially in stop-and-go city traffic, the hybrid system helps cut down fuel consumption noticeably.
Performance and Practical Features for Nepali Roads
One of the biggest strengths of the Grand Vitara is its balance between size and ground clearance.
The SUV offers 210 mm of ground clearance, making it suitable for broken roads, rural tracks, and speed bumps that are common in Nepal.
The 1.5-litre engine delivers between 88 to 102 bhp, depending on the hybrid configuration.
This may not make it the most powerful SUV, but it is practical and efficient for daily use.
For highway drives and family trips, the Grand Vitara’s cabin feels spacious enough for five passengers.
Its boot space is practical for luggage, though hybrid variants lose some space due to the battery pack.
Fuel Economy and Maintenance
Fuel cost is a major concern for Nepali buyers.
The Grand Vitara hybrid claims to deliver mileage figures in the 20–25 kmpl range under ideal test conditions.
In real-world Nepali conditions with hills and traffic, expect slightly lower but still impressive numbers compared to non-hybrid SUVs.
Maintenance costs are relatively manageable, thanks to Suzuki’s strong dealer presence in Nepal.
Basic parts like filters, oils, and brake components are widely available.
However, hybrid-specific components may take longer to source and can be more expensive, so buyers should confirm warranty coverage for these.
Safety and Technology
Safety is another highlight of the Grand Vitara.
Depending on the variant, safety features include:
- Dual or six airbags
- ABS with EBD
- Electronic Stability Control
- Hill Hold Assist
- ISOFIX child seat anchors
Higher trims like the Alpha also come with a 360-degree camera, ventilated seats, a large touchscreen infotainment system, wireless Android Auto/Apple CarPlay, and premium interiors.

Availability, Warranty, and Dealer Support
Suzuki Nepal has introduced the Grand Vitara as part of its premium lineup.
Warranty coverage generally includes 3 years or 100,000 km, depending on the dealer.
Hybrid system coverage may have special terms, so always ask for written confirmation.
Suzuki’s service network is widespread across Nepal, which makes servicing easier compared to some other premium brands.

Used Grand Vitara Market in Nepal
The used market for the Grand Vitara is still small, as it is a relatively new model.
However, some early buyers are beginning to list their cars.
Used prices usually depend on year, mileage, and variant.
For buyers considering a used Grand Vitara, it is crucial to check hybrid battery health, service history, and accident records.
